Pricing

Primrose Retirement Community of Pueblo offers competitive pricing compared to both Pueblo County and the broader state of Colorado. For instance, the monthly cost for a semi-private room at Primrose is $1,980, significantly lower than the county average of $3,549 and the state average of $4,009. This trend continues across other room types as well; a studio apartment is priced at $2,100 versus Pueblo County's $3,546 and Colorado's $4,090. In one-bedroom accommodations, Primrose charges $2,695, again well below the local county rate of $4,054 and the statewide figure of $4,119. Even in two-bedroom units priced at $2,895 - less than both Pueblo County and Colorado averages - Primrose Retirement Community stands out as an affordable option for individuals seeking quality care and comfortable living arrangements in the area. Overall, Primrose provides a cost-effective choice without compromising on the quality of life for its residents.

Room TypePrimrose Retirement Community Of PuebloPueblo CountyColorado
Semi-Private$1,980$3,549$4,009
Studio$2,100$3,546$4,090
1 Bedroom$2,695$4,054$4,119
2 Bedrooms$2,895$3,817$4,580

Review

Primrose Retirement Community of Pueblo has garnered an impressive reputation among its residents and their families, showcasing a clean, modern facility that prioritizes comfort and care for its elderly occupants. The community stands out due to its close proximity to family homes, which adds convenience for visitors while fostering familial bonds. Many reviews highlight the aesthetically pleasing nature of the accommodations, with spacious apartments and well-maintained common areas contributing to a warm and inviting atmosphere. Families appreciate being able to tour the entire facility before making decisions, ensuring transparency about the environment in which their loved ones will reside.

The quality of services rendered at Primrose is another aspect frequently lauded in the reviews. Residents benefit from access to physical therapists and personalized care options based on their individual needs and assessments. The responsive nursing staff and certified nursing assistants (CNAs) are described as knowledgeable and attentive, providing peace of mind for families concerned about their loved ones’ health needs. The provision of various levels of monitoring based on capability demonstrates a commitment to tailored support for each resident.

Dining experiences at Primrose seem to be a highlight for many reviewers. The community offers an enticing menu that echoes restaurant dining rather than standard institutional fare. With clean dining facilities resembling elegant restaurants, meals are not just about nourishment but also offer enjoyable social experiences. Some reviews note that while the food is consistently praised, it may not always align with traditional homestyle cooking preferences, implying that gourmet inspirations might take precedence over comforting classics.

Activities play a crucial role in enhancing residents' quality of life at Primrose Retirement Community. Reviewers appreciate the extensive range of recreational offerings available—notably during times when restrictions have made regular events challenging due to COVID-19 concerns. From gaming activities and movie nights to organized day trips and church services, there seems to be no shortage of engagement for residents who wish to stay active socially and physically. The dedicated activity directors are commended for their involvement in organizing these events, ensuring residents feel valued and entertained.

Despite its many positives, some feedback points out that Primrose Retirement Community comes with higher costs compared to alternative options in the area. While many find the value justifiable given the quality of care and amenities offered—such as an ice cream parlor, movie theater, gymnasium, beauty shop, puzzle room, library space, snack bar possibilities—they also suggest potential residents consider budget constraints seriously before committing. For families seeking more affordable assisted living options or specific room sizes not available at Primrose may choose other communities despite receiving excellent service during their visits.
